
In the past, companies grew by building larger sales teams or spending more on marketing. But in today’s data-driven world, sustainable growth is not about doing more—it’s about doing it smarter. That’s where Revops agencies come in.
Revops (Revenue Operations) is transforming how businesses structure their revenue teams. Instead of siloed departments chasing different KPIs, Revops aligns sales, marketing, and customer success around a single source of truth. Revops agencies help companies design and implement this alignment for long-term growth.
Let’s explore how these agencies are reshaping go-to-market strategies and why so many businesses are investing in them.
The Shift From Traditional Operations to Revops
In traditional setups, each revenue function—sales, marketing, and customer success—operates in its own lane. They often use separate tools, track different metrics, and rarely collaborate in real-time. The result? Miscommunication, inefficiencies, and lost revenue.
Revops changes that. It brings all revenue-generating teams under one operational umbrella. With unified systems, shared goals, and centralized data, companies can:
- Improve forecasting accuracy
- Shorten the sales cycle
- Increase customer retention
- Make faster, data-driven decisions
This transition can be complex—especially for growing companies. That’s why many turn to Revops agencies for expert guidance and execution.
What Do Revops Agencies Actually Do?
Revops agencies act as strategic partners, helping businesses restructure their revenue processes and systems. Their services often include:
- Revenue process auditing: Identifying bottlenecks and inefficiencies
- CRM optimization: Cleaning and customizing platforms like Salesforce or HubSpot
- Tech stack integration: Ensuring tools work together smoothly
- Lead-to-revenue mapping: Tracking customer journeys from first touch to retention
- KPI development: Establishing consistent metrics across departments
- Automated reporting: Building dashboards for real-time visibility
Whether you’re starting from scratch or scaling an existing operation, a Revops agency provides the structure and expertise to drive results.
Why Are Revops Agencies in High Demand?
Here are the top reasons fast-growing companies are investing in Revops agency partnerships:
1. Better Alignment = Better Performance
Misalignment between teams leads to confusion, duplicate efforts, and finger-pointing. Revops agencies foster collaboration by aligning everyone under shared revenue goals, tools, and workflows. When sales and marketing work in sync, both conversion rates and deal velocity improve.
2. Data-Driven Decisions at Every Level
Modern businesses generate massive amounts of data—but that data is only useful if it’s clean, connected, and actionable. Revops agencies ensure your data infrastructure supports real-time reporting and predictive analytics. This leads to better decision-making across departments.
3. Smoother Customer Journeys
Disconnected teams often create inconsistent customer experiences. With Revops in place, leads are nurtured consistently, deals close faster, and customers receive proactive support. This smooth experience improves satisfaction and boosts lifetime value.
4. Scalability Without Chaos
Growth can bring chaos if systems aren’t built to scale. A Revops agency implements processes that grow with your business. Whether you’re expanding your sales team, entering a new market, or launching a new product, your operations stay steady.
5. Maximized ROI on Tools
Many companies overspend on software they don’t fully use. Revops agencies optimize your tech stack, eliminate redundant tools, and ensure each platform is configured for impact. The result? Lower costs and higher productivity.
Who Should Consider Working with a Revops Agency?
Revops agencies aren’t just for enterprise giants. They’re ideal for:
- Startups preparing for rapid growth
- Mid-market companies struggling with forecasting and efficiency
- SaaS providers needing better customer lifecycle tracking
- B2B service businesses wanting more predictable revenue
If your business depends on aligning people, platforms, and processes to drive revenue, a Revops agency can provide the roadmap.
Key Traits of a Great Revops Agency
Choosing the right agency is critical. Here’s what to look for:
- Cross-functional experience across sales, marketing, and CS
- Strong CRM expertise (Salesforce, HubSpot, etc.)
- Proven methodology for implementation and change management
- Customizable solutions, not cookie-cutter approaches
- Data fluency for building insightful reporting dashboards
Most importantly, they should work collaboratively with your team—not just advise, but help execute.
